The Jersey Devil

Well something of a Blair Witch documentary The three of us on dark, dark October night We parked our car and took our flashlights Deep into the pitch black woods trying to prove Or disprove the legend of the ghost man Well maybe it's just the idea of it all but I do Feel like I'm being watched, don’t you feel it to Wait a minute, stop, look and listen don't you hear That, it sounds like it's coming from over there And all around us, I said hello is there anyone There, you said boy do you really wanna know Well I don't know about you but why don't we Just forget about this and go home but she Became speechless and as we turned around we Came face to face with THE JERSEY DEVIL... I never ran so fast in all my life trying to make It back to the car and the old dirt road and to be Honest with you I forgot all about them 'cuz it's Now I know there are things in the darkness Wicked and abnormal, thank God for watching Over us but I don't think I'll ever sleep again... Oooh Jeepers creepers and now here we are Again after twenty years going down that same Ole dirt road and I'm just sitting on pins and Needles, you’d think me crazy if I told you why Sometimes you just have to prove yourself wrong Because after all these years you still can't believe You saw what you saw with your own two eyes And but if I saw what I think I really saw well I can't believe I'm still alive and if you don't Believe me just go ahead and ask them, ask them The night from out of the twilight zone, the night We came face to face with THE JERSEY DEVIL I remember it as tho it were yesterday even to this Day I still have nightmares of that dark, dark October Night, the night we came face to face with the JERSEY DEVIL and ran, ran for our lives!
